He meant that if you want 2gb then you should drop one of your 512 mb sticks and buy a 1gb stick to avoid populating all of your dimm slots. You'll only be forced to run at DDR333 if you use 4 sticks.
 
i only have 2 slots of dimm, im running sockt 754, so it i drop the 512 and get 1 gb im going to go down anyways, and if i dont then ill stay at ddr 333 but at 1.5 gb thats why its so confsuing for me!

no, you wouldn't. the DFI lanparty nf3 250gb is pretty much the best socket754 board ever made. you wouldn't have to upgrade anything. it has AGP video and 3 DIMM slots. i'm using 2 1GB sticks at DDR454, 1T. i wouldn't recommend a simple motherboard upgrade to many people but i think i would really help you out. the only thing is the hassle involved in gutting your system- always a pain.
whether you do or not, i still think you should ditch the 512MB stick, regardless.
